2010 has been a good year forWe Were Pirates. In January, the debut full-length, "Cutting Ties" reached #41 on theCMJtop 200 charts for college music airplay. Then, more recently,MTVfeatured the song, "Settle Down" on episode 11 of "The Real World: DC." And in July,E!played “Long Year” on “Kourtney and Khloe Take Miami.”
We Were Pirates is DC-area native and multi-instrumentalist, Mike Boggs. Boggs writes and records his silly pop songs in his home-studio. On "Cutting Ties", as with the debut EP, “The Wolf”, every instrument was performed and recorded entirely by Boggs in his home studio. The new songs are something of a departure from the quieter, more subdued style of the EP. “Cutting Ties” is louder, poppier, and catchier than the catchiest dog-catcher.
“Cutting Ties” features a version of "The Three of Us," a cover song that Boggs recorded which was featured on the Chicago Public Radio show,This American Life.As a result,Chicago Tribunerock critic and co-host ofSound Opinions, Greg Kot, heard We Were Pirates’ version of the song and described it thusly: "Pure pop. This should be the next Fountains of Wayne single...genius."
At the moment, We Were Pirates is playing shows with a band comprised of Gabe Fry (The NRI’s, Lejune, The Alphabetical Order) and Ben Skinner as well as working on demos for a follow-up record in 2011.
